Horizontal line draw issue
Just noticed on NT 7.10 that when trying to adjust Y axis using data input tab horizontal line value reverts to initial value, for example I place a line at "800" on the Y axis then double click and it shows "801.1" in the data tab, then I input "800" in the data field click apply and value reverts to "801.1". Same on all charts.

Hello DeskTroll,
I tested the Data-tab of a Line object and I was able to reproduce the addition of 0.001 when modifying an Y-value. However, the line was not drawn 1 point above the value. Can you please decompress the Y-axis and draw another line. Check if the Y-axis values are reported correctly under the Data-tab.
I will report my findings to Development. Once there is news regarding the matter, I will let you know.

Can you please rebooot your PC and start NinjaTrader. Create a brand new chart and draw a Line.
Double click the line and select the Data-tab. Remove all information next to 'Start Y' and enter a new value. Click Apply.
Does the old value still reflect in the window?
I am not able to reproduce this on my end. For example, I draw a line from 1134.792 to 1133.201. I change 1134.792 to 1133 and I click Apply. The value will be reflected as 1133.002, but not as 1134.792.
